my car is overheating at stops low gears. i turn on the heat and it goes down high speeds im good. ol i checked the fans and they work, i dont see leaks or puddles under the car even after i let it run hot for 20 minutes. but heres the thing that got me real confused i fill up the radiator with fluid and the reserve ad recomended about a gallon of fluid i have put in the past 2 weeks. and everytime i check the fluids when it overheats its bone dry. i did buy the car used so im still figuring out whats wrong with it. could it have been that bone dry that its taking all the fluids? any and all help is appreciated. thanks in advance.

Rad cap check and see whats going on in your overflow tank.
Here is a tip, get the car nice and warm, preferably in the morning while its still cool out or when there is condensation on your car, get out real quick open the hood and look for steam. I had to do that 3 times before i finally saw some steam and rad fluid burning on the block. It was a small coolant hose clamp that was loose going to the intake manifold. Get a flush and maybe a pressure test if you cant find it right away. And like everyone else said check the main signs of a leaking HG.

Well anything from the interior will be the heater core. Check for any wet spots on the carpet or mats, that should guarantee the heater core leaking.
Usually if the water pump is going you should be able to hear a squeaking or howling. From a bearing i believe. If you cant find it yourself a rad place would be your best bet. Good luck and keep us posted.
